Planning Officer

Overview:

If you have relevant experience within the development management, planning or environmental sector and are looking to develop your career, this could be the role for you.

By joining us as a Planning Officer at Buckinghamshire Council, you’ll not only be offered a competitive benefits package, you’ll also be part of an established team committed to shaping the future of Buckinghamshire for generations to come.

About the role:

Working as part of a friendly team on a wide variety of complex projects, you’ll be based in our Buckinghamshire offices, where you’ll manage a diverse caseload of planning related applications, appeals and compliance investigations. Spanning from interpreting complex policies, to representing the Council at Local Authority meetings - this role will offer you exposure in all areas of our Planning and Environment Service.

Skills & Experience/About You:

Naturally, you’ll have excellent communication skills and experience of dealing with complex customer queries. You’ll come to us with the relevant specialist experience within the service or a related area, and a proven ability to prioritise a demanding workload. Most importantly, you’ll be people-focussed and enjoy building new relationships, with the welfare of our residents at the heart of what you do.
